Transaction d66a5975d8a2bba3e6bb32023c3d6f67980296a251cd83ab9105166ae959fc41

1 Input
2 Outputs
  • d66a5975d8a2bba3e6bb32023c3d6f67980296a251cd83ab9105166ae959fc41:0
  • value  722015619
    address  36EZvkdFtEhCgJGYfZMKLWfastEDFj55Wz
  • d66a5975d8a2bba3e6bb32023c3d6f67980296a251cd83ab9105166ae959fc41:1
  • value  99850000
    address  1KpyUE3cwGbKgJc2cpbfiakrDGuA4jjuW6